ส่วนติดต่อผู้ใช้เว็บไซต์ช้า และการเปลี่ยนแปลงใด ๆ ก็ตามมาด้วยบั๊กมากมาย? React แก้ปัญหานี้ด้วยสถาปัตยกรรมแบบ component: แบ่งส่วนติดต่อผู้ใช้ออกเป็นส่วน ๆ คุณเปลี่ยนส่วนหนึ่ง — ส่วนอื่นไม่พัง SPA ไม่ต้องโหลดซ้ำ TypeScript เพื่อความน่าเชื่อถือ Next.js สำหรับ SEO ระบบนิเวศที่มีไลบรารีสำหรับทุกงาน

สิ่งที่เรานำเสนอ

พัฒนาเว็บไซต์ด้วย React — การสร้างแอปพลิเคชันหน้าเดียวและส่วนติดต่อผู้ใช้ที่ซับซ้อนบนไลบรารี frontend ที่ได้รับความนิยมมากที่สุดในโลก แนวทางแบบ component, DOM เสมือน และระบบนิเวศอันอุดมสมบูรณ์ช่วยให้สร้างส่วนติดต่อผู้ใช้ทุกระดับความซับซ้อนได้

  • พัฒนาด้วย React 18 และ TypeScript — การกำหนดชนิดข้อมูลที่เข้มงวด, การ refactor ที่คาดเดาได้, การสนับสนุน IDE ที่ยอดเยี่ยม

  • Next.js สำหรับ server-side rendering และ static generation — โหลดเร็วและ SEO ที่ยอดเยี่ยม

  • การจัดการ state ด้วย Redux Toolkit, Zustand หรือ MobX — เลือกเครื่องมือให้เหมาะกับขนาดโครงการ

  • การสื่อสารที่โปร่งใส, sprint ที่แน่นอน และรายงานที่ชัดเจน

React 18 · Next.js · TypeScript · Redux

เครื่องมือและเทคโนโลยีการพัฒนา React

React ไม่ใช่เพียงไลบรารีสำหรับการเรนเดอร์ แต่เป็นระบบนิเวศทั้งหมดที่มีโซลูชันสำหรับ routing, การจัดการ state, server-side rendering และการทดสอบ

React 18 / TypeScript

Concurrent rendering, Suspense, Server Components เราใช้ทุกความสามารถของ React เวอร์ชันล่าสุดพร้อมการกำหนดชนิดข้อมูลที่สมบูรณ์

Next.js

Server-side rendering, static generation, incremental regeneration เฟรมเวิร์กที่เหมาะสำหรับ เว็บไซต์ สาธารณะที่มี SEO SEO audit เมื่อเปิดตัว

Redux / Zustand / MobX

Redux Toolkit สำหรับโครงการใหญ่ที่มี state ที่คาดเดาได้ Zustand สำหรับโซลูชันที่รวดเร็ว MobX สำหรับแนวทาง reactive

React Query / TanStack Query

การจัดการ server state: caching, revalidation, การแบ่งหน้า, optimistic updates — โดยไม่ต้องมี boilerplate

Jest / React Testing Library

การทดสอบ component และ hook RTL ตรวจสอบพฤติกรรมจากมุมมองของผู้ใช้ ไม่ใช่รายละเอียดการนำไปใช้

Storybook / Chromatic

การพัฒนา component แบบแยกส่วนพร้อมการทดสอบการถดถอยทางภาพ ระบบการออกแบบที่ทั้งทีมมองเห็น

React — เมื่อส่วนติดต่อผู้ใช้ถูกแบ่งออกเป็น component ที่แยกจากกัน แต่ละตัวมีตรรกะและสไตล์ของตัวเอง เราสร้างระบบการออกแบบในโค้ดเพื่อให้นักพัฒนาใหม่สามารถประกอบหน้าจอจากบล็อกสำเร็จรูปได้ภายในหนึ่งชั่วโมง แทนที่จะเขียนจากศูนย์

React 18 Next.js TypeScript Redux Toolkit Zustand React Query Jest Storybook Vite

วงจรการพัฒนา React อย่างครบวงจร

การสร้างเว็บไซต์ด้วย React ไม่ใช่แค่การเขียนโค้ด แพ็คเกจรวมทุกสิ่งที่จำเป็นสำหรับการโหลดที่รวดเร็ว SEO ที่ยอดเยี่ยม และการบำรุงรักษาส่วนติดต่อผู้ใช้ที่สะดวก

  • การออกแบบสถาปัตยกรรม — โครงสร้าง component, routing, การจัดการ state, กลยุทธ์การโหลดข้อมูล

  • การรวม API — React Query สำหรับ caching และการซิงค์ server state, Axios สำหรับคำขอ HTTP

  • SSR และ SEO สำหรับ React — Next.js server-side rendering, meta tag, Open Graph และ structured data สำหรับการมองเห็นในเครื่องมือค้นหา

  • UI-kit ใน Storybook — จัดทำเอกสารทุก component นักออกแบบและนักพัฒนาพูดภาษาเดียวกัน

  • การทดสอบ — Unit test ด้วย Jest, component test ด้วย React Testing Library, E2E ด้วย Playwright

  • Next.js และเฟรมเวิร์กที่สมบูรณ์ — server component, App Router, ISR และ Streaming SSR เพื่อประสิทธิภาพสูงสุดและการปรับแต่ง SEO


Server-side rendering ด้วย Next.js — SEO ที่ไม่มีการประนีประนอม

เครื่องมือค้นหาเห็นเนื้อหาที่เรนเดอร์อย่างสมบูรณ์ ผู้ใช้ได้รับการโหลดทันที เหมาะสำหรับร้านค้าออนไลน์ บล็อก และแพลตฟอร์มสาธารณะ

ทำไมต้องเลือกการพัฒนา React กับเรา

การสั่งทำเว็บไซต์ React — หมายถึงการได้รับผลิตภัณฑ์ ที่ตอบสนองต่อการกระทำของผู้ใช้ทันที โหลดเร็ว และปรับขนาดได้ง่าย

Next.js และ App Router

Server Component, Server Actions, Streaming SSR ประสิทธิภาพสูงสุดและ SEO ด้วย JavaScript ขั้นต่ำบน client

State Management

Redux Toolkit / Zustand พร้อม slice ที่กำหนดชนิด, middleware สำหรับ caching, ปรับปรุงการ re-render ผ่าน React.memo และ useMemo

UI-component และ Storybook

ไลบรารี component ของตัวเองพร้อมการพัฒนาแบบแยกส่วนและการทดสอบทางภาพ สไตล์ที่เป็นหนึ่งเดียวทั่วทั้งโครงการ

เว็บไซต์ React — ไม่ใช่แค่หน้าเพจ แต่เป็นแอปพลิเคชันที่สมบูรณ์ในเบราว์เซอร์ เราสร้างส่วนติดต่อผู้ใช้ที่ทำงานอย่างลื่นไหล โหลดทันที และไม่ต้องโหลดหน้าใหม่ทุกครั้งที่คลิก

มาพูดคุยกัน

อย่าลังเลที่จะติดต่อเราสำหรับข้อสงสัยหรือโอกาสในการทำงานร่วมกัน

ปรึกษาโครงการ